Horner praises Ricciardo

Christian Horner says he is pleased with how Daniel Ricciardo responded to his disappointing Qualifying session with a P4 finish. Red Bull boss has expressed his delight with his driver Daniel Ricciardo's P4 finish at the Hungarian Grand Prix on Sunday. Ricciardo started outside the top ten following his disappointing Qualifying session, but almost reached the podium in a race that his Red Bull team were confident about. The Aussie had a collision with Mercedes' Valtteri Bottas that knocked him off the track but managed to overtake the Finn on the last lap, something that made his boss Christian Horner very pleased.
